Does anyone know of any good gunsmiths in the Willamette Valley? I've got a couple of small jobs that are just beyond my ability, and am hoping to find someone that I don't have to ship the gun to.

Trigger work on a CZ75 and barrel indexing on a revolver are first up. If the guy is good I might have more things to do.

-- Sam
 
I'm told Rangemaster Gunworks is pretty good. He's on Knox Butte Road off of highway 20. When I moved here five years ago, he was closed sunday and mondays. A year later, he started staying closed on Wednesdays, due to high demand for his gunsmithing. Now he is only open 3 days a week, with the extra day spent on gunsmithing.

I stopped in Saturday to have him work on my Kel-tec, after I broke the ejector. He swapped it out on the spot, no charge. Now it was a simple operation, once I saw him do it, but he's got a custmoer in me, just for that small courtesy.
